GenomeUp at a glance

GenomeUp generates $229.9K in revenue with 31 employees, headquartered in Rome, Italy.

GenomeUp is an AI platform for enabling doctors and clinical institutions to diagnose and treat rare genetic diseases in less than 24 hours.

Upscore at a glance

Upscore generates $222.4K in revenue with 9 employees, headquartered in Hamburg, Germany.

UpScore provides a comprehensive Content-Intelligence solution to measure, analyze and increase the success of digital content.
